Condition: Como nuevo. : En el año 3580, la Mancomunidad Intersolar se ha extendido por toda la galaxia. Sus ciudadanos son privilegiados y protegidos por una poderosa armada. Sin embargo, en el centro de esta galaxia se encuentra el Vacío, un universo sellado creado por extraterrestres hace miles de millones de años. Y el Vacío está lejos de ser inerte. Su expansión ha ido consumiendo gradualmente los sistemas estelares cercanos, y ahora está intentando establecer contacto. El Vacío elige a Íñigo como su conducto, y él canaliza sueños de una vida más sencilla dentro de sus límites. La humanidad, descontenta, anhela esta visión y lo adopta como su profeta. Pero Íñigo desaparece y sus seguidores instigan una peregrinación para llevarlos al propio Vacío. Un acto que podría desencadenar su expansión y, por tanto, dañar nuestra galaxia de forma irreparable. Mientras tanto, dentro del Vacío, un agente de policía de segunda categoría llamado Edeard comienza su camino hacia la grandeza. Se enfrenta a su ciudad corrupta, dando esperanza a su pueblo.
